Struct Weavatrix 

Source
pub struct Weavatrix { /* private fields */ }

Implementations§

Source§

impl Weavatrix

Source

pub fn open(root: impl AsRef<Path>) -> Result<Self>

Opens and analyzes one local repository without running its code.

§Errors

Returns scan, parser, or graph validation failures.

Source

pub const fn state(&self) -> &RepositoryState

Source

pub fn rebuild(&mut self) -> Result<()>

Rebuilds only the derived in-memory snapshot.

§Errors

Returns scan, parser, or graph validation failures.

Source

pub fn refresh_if_stale(&mut self) -> Result<bool>

Checks the incremental scanner revision and rebuilds only when source evidence changed.

§Errors

Returns scan, parser, or graph validation failures.

Source

pub fn open_repository(&mut self, root: impl AsRef<Path>) -> Result<()>

Retargets this process to another local repository.

§Errors

Returns scan, parser, or graph validation failures.

Source

pub fn open_repository_with_build( &mut self, root: impl AsRef<Path>, build: bool, ) -> Result<bool>

Retargets this process, optionally requiring a fresh graph build.

With build == false, only a repository already opened by this process can be activated. Its exact analyzed state is retained in memory, so a no-build switch never scans or executes repository code.

§Errors

Returns scan/parser failures for a requested build, or a concrete missing-cache error for a no-build request.
